Position Description
The Asset Forfeiture Division is charged with the responsibility of investigating and prosecuting all seizures of contraband pursuant to Chapter 59 of the Texas Code of Criminal Procedure.
This position provides the opportunity to practice civil litigation, understand and apply criminal investigative and legal concepts, manage your own caseload, supervise a paralegal, and work closely with other areas of criminal prosecution, including Major Narcotics and Money Laundering.
The Asset Forfeiture Division seizes and forfeits contraband from criminals, including cash, vehicles, boats, jewelry, gambling devices, gambling proceeds, and other property related to the proceeds of criminal activity.
We work to "take the profit out of crime."Asset Forfeiture provides a great way to learn both civil and criminal law and the practical application of both.
